Analyse problem of rampant quicksand of Yansui Middle Road and the Fierce in Wan Li period of Ming D

Article Summary by: TsingHua    

Original Author: Journal of Inner Mongolia University(Humanities and Sciences)
This abstract was translated from 万历间延绥中路边墙流沙猖獗原因探析
In Ming Dynasty,about the exploration of the Inner Mongolian Western area,the process was temporary and the influences which
were coursed by the humanbeing was limited.The distributive power about the Ming and the Mongolia showed that the Ming central government hadn't governed this area for long time.The Ming Royal set up some governments called Wei to control this area.After the Zheng Tong 14's Tumu Coup,some of the Wei were abolished,others moved.The Ming's orbit withdrew to Datong,Pianguan,which is the trace of today's Ming Great wall.Tumo Plain and Manhan Mountain were abandoned.For the Erduos,the Ming Royal had never established government to control this place. The Erduos' ecology was delicate,and from the beginning of the Ming Dynasty to Zheng Tong,nearly 70 years,no people explored this place.From Zheng Tong to Cheng Hua 8,during this period,only planting at Yulin and other 22 barracks.After that,the Ming's soldiers and people had stopped the mass and centralized exploration on the Hetao and the southern area of the Maowusu Desert.Consequently,the history materials mentioned the problems in the Wan Li period,such as the sand stuffed up the side wall of the Yansui Middle Road and the fierce quicksand of the southeast area of the Maowusu Desert factors.
